Wildlife Photography and Cultural Expedition
(Black Howler Monkey vocalization)
This awesome adventure includes 7 days/6 nights travel around the country of Belize and into the village of El Remate and Tikal, Guatemala to explore Central America's most significant Mayan ruins and photograph its wildlife. We travel in a comfortable and spacious air-conditioned vehicle with plenty of room for you and your gear. This is one of our most popular expeditions.
Knowledgeable guides assist with species identification, wildlife photography instruction, and natural history interpretation. This trip involves a combinaton of comfortable hotel stays and restaurant visits to sample local flavors. We also visit with and dine at the home of a friendly family in Belize to experience a taste of local culture.
Possible sightings may include Black Howler Monkey, a variety of Parrot species, Baird's Tapir, Coatimundi, American Crocodile, Jabiru Stork, & 3 species of Toucans (Keel-Billed Toucan, Collared Araçari, & Emerald Toucanet) and many more, viewable amidst the lush tropical rain forest! With extreme good fortune, Jaguar, as we visit the world's only Jaguar Preserve in Cockscomb Basin, Belize.
The trip begins and ends at the Philip S.W. Goldson International Airport (BZE) in Belize City, Belize.
